1. LG G2
Possibly the best phone of the moment now is the LG G2, but mostly for reasons of quality / price. The large display of 5.2 inches high quality, 800 Snapdragon processor that can get high performance at 1920x1080 pixel resolution in games, and a huge 3,000 mAh battery. It is one of the phones with better battery life out there in the market.
The display has a minimum edges to that size does not become unmanageable. One detail that may shock at first is that the power and volume buttons have them in the middle back. Its display has a brightness of 450 nits, a little low to be seamlessly broad daylight, but the contrast 1400: 1 and the quality of the colors make it pretty good. The camera has been perhaps a little behind (it is a terminal of a year ago), but still very good for the price of the terminal. Give them a tour of our analysis of the LG G2.

2. Huawei Honor 6
The Honor 6 features 8-core SoC based on ARM technology Big.little. In other words, with two groups of 4 cores, and activated either group depending on the power requirements have the application you are using. This lets you choose from a group of high performance, consumer, or other lower performance and lower power consumption.
The design of the phone is attractive, but the glossy plastic finish instead of matte back makes it particularly slippery and can slide on surfaces other than rough or eg are varnished. Also the rear is damaged quite easily, so it is a device you need to be careful.
The camera of Honor 6 is a clear example that more megapixels do not provide better quality photos. It is a good camera, look good photos at night or in low light (not as much as high-end phones), but in broad daylight, but the pictures are good, they lack clear detail that itself is obtained a camera 8 megapixels like the iPhone 5s.
What's interesting about this is that in Settings terminal has an option of "Rog", which when activated will restart the phone with screen resolution 1280x720 pixels instead of the native 1920x1080 pixels. This allows the games run at a level of performance comparable to Adreno GPU 330 and reduces overall consumption of the device. It is very convenient for users who do not have bionic eye, although the envelope scaling of the image is incredibly sharp.
For small phone having this terminal, and the lack of extras such as fingerprints or water resistance or increased resistance to falls, sensor is what stays in the upper midrange.

12. Sony Xperia Xperia Z1 and Z1 Compact
The Xperia Z1 and Z1 Compact can be considered as the same phone with different format. They, except for the size and resolution of the screen, with the same hardware. Its strong point is the 20-megapixel camera, and the element in which more has focused Sony to promote their sale. It is without doubt the best cameras on the market, second only to his older brothers Z2 and Z3, as well as the iPhone 6 and S5.
Moreover, as the Xperia Z, is also waterproof and dust and is well built and includes the best of current hardware: 800 Snapdragon processor and 2GB of RAM. The Xperia Z1 has 5-inch 1080p and Z1 Compact has a 4.3-inch 720p. It has a brightness of 500 nits, on the edge of being either broad daylight. The battery behaves normal, although its size is 3000 mAh. With the latest updates to Android 4.4.4 behaves much better, so the update is mandatory.
The design can also be appealing to many potential buyers because of its manufacturing aluminum frame and rear glass, which removes from among the feeling plastic LG G2.
